SOTD: Noir Extreme edp by Tom Ford 03/01/2026
My First bottle of 2026, picked this up yesterday, it's been on the list for a while and the price was right. That said I also managed to get my nose on the new release of The One parfum. They had no stock yet, just the display bottle which I was allowed to spray away with. Initial thoughts, Wow. It seems to be a deeper, richer, and smoother take on the classic The One DNA. I'm hoping that this is a sign that they have listened and improved the performance issues of the OG. Anyway back to Noir Extreme, if I was too only ever have 3 Tom Ford fragrances iin my collection it would be Ombre Leather, Black Orchid and of course Noir Extreme. I first got my nose on this last year in a discovery set and fell in love. Well now I got it and nothing has changed. This is an amazing fragrance and a great way to start the year off. I'm gonna call this what it is, a woody Oriental masterpiece, it's classic, seductive and sophisticated scent that IMO can be worn equally well by man or woman. There is a girl that wears this a lot in my office and you can follow the scent trail in the mornings. Itsvery addictive and recognisable.But can it break into my top 5, let's see. I will say that Sonia Constant certainly gives Alienor Massenet a run for her money as my favourite perfumery with this one. The opening is a vivid energetic blend of spices and citrus. You'll immediately notice the exotic warmth of Cardamom, Saffron, and Nutmeg, which isbalanced by a s sharp burst of Mandarin and Neroli. This initial phase is like the Spicey and sweet are sparring in the ring for dominance. At its core, the fragrance distinguishes itself with that rather unique Indian Kulfi accord. I don't think I've come across this in a fragrance before? It's an Indian dessert which is paired with Rose Absolute, Jasmine and Orange Blossom, which adds a layer of complexity and a subtle richness. At the base you get one of the most sensual and long-lasting dry downs I've experienced. It starts with that Amber accord which is deep, resinous and warming. Anchored by a rich Sandalwood and a molten, sweet Vanilla ember, leaving a lingering, addictive, and deeply satisfying trail on the skin. I swear this fast creeping up my fragrance charts. It's looking like an New Year's New Entry?

Top 25 Perfumes of 2025
This is my personal list. Not all of these were released in 2025, just picked up and worn by me for the first time in 2025. This is very subjective, and I'm putting it in a little bit of an order, but just know that the order is fairly loose and changes all the time. 1). Fine'ry Magical Nomad. I keep talking about this one, but i think Byredo Gypsy Water is one of my absolute favorite scent profiles. It leans feminine, and is very powdery, and definitely not for everyone, but I think that it fits me in a way that most other scents don't. I've worn the original and a couple of other clones (notably Oakcha's version), and Nomad just nails the profile and has better longevity. 2). Prisma Parfums Citron - This became my go to scent over the summer. Citrus orange with a powdery musk. Smelled fresh even in the highest heat, and was really enjoyable and fun to wear. 3). House of Mammoth Everett - Similar to Citron but with a sweeter scent. Almost like an orange julius (for those who remember) in a fragrance, but without the cloying sweetness. Supported a good cause and was a fun surprise. I didn't like it on the first wear, but completely fell in love by the time I used up the sample. 4). Hexenhaus Hexenacht 23 - Smelled like the old head shops where I used to get my "tobacco" supplies back before I quit smoking and drinking. Reminded me so much of my youth that it was quite the nostalgia trip. Not sure I would buy a full bottle of this, but I did love wearing it. 5). Jaques Fath Velours Boise - Now discontinued, picked it up on clearance from FragranceNet along with Sur le Verde for about $25 for 100 mL. Nice and woody, it was perfect for the fall, and I'm looking forward to wearing it again in the spring. It's a great workhorse fragrance perfect for the office and shooting weddings. 6). Mauboussin Star Pour Homme - One of the best vanilla fragrances I've ever owned. It smells like a $300 fragrance, but sells for around $35. This was a blind buy, and I was super happy with the results. There's a feminine version that's supposed to lean unisex, and I might pick that one up, too.
